We hear the anguish and desperation in your cry, and we stand with you in the authority of Jesus Christ to rebuke every lying spirit, every tormenting force, and every scheme of the enemy that has sought to oppress you. The Word of God declares, "Submit yourselves therefore to God. Resist the devil, and he will flee from you" (James 4:7 WEB). You are not powerless—you are a child of the Most High God, and in the name of Jesus, we command every spirit of confusion, oppression, and deception to flee from you now. The enemy has no right to use you as his sport, for you were bought with a price—the precious blood of Jesus Christ (1 Corinthians 6:20).

We must address the manner in which you are speaking to the enemy. While it is right to resist Satan, we do not "speak things into existence" as if we hold the same creative power as God. That is a dangerous deception. Our words have power, but only because they align with God’s Word and His will. We do not decree or declare apart from Him—we pray, we submit, and we trust in His sovereignty. "For ‘He has put all things in subjection under His feet.’ But when He says, ‘All things are put in subjection,’ it is evident that He is excepted who subjected all things to Him" (1 Corinthians 15:27 WEB). Our authority is in Christ alone, not in our own declarations.

We also notice that your plea does not mention the name of Jesus, and this is a critical oversight. There is no victory, no deliverance, and no salvation apart from Him. "Jesus said to him, ‘I am the way, the truth, and the life. No one comes to the Father, except through Me’" (John 14:6 WEB). If you have not surrendered your life to Jesus Christ, we urge you to do so now. Confess your sins, believe in His death and resurrection, and receive Him as your Lord and Savior. Only then can you walk in true freedom and authority.
